Comments

EuroSouvenir notes are legal tender for zero euros — a designation that makes them collectible without requiring central bank authorization under EU rules. Oberthur Fiduciaire produces them to full security-printing specification, the same facility responsible for banknotes of numerous African and European nations, which is part of why the series has attracted serious collector interest despite its obvious novelty origins.

The Convento de San Esteban in Salamanca has a documented connection to the financing of Columbus's first voyage — the Dominican friars there reportedly lobbied Fernando and Isabel on his behalf. Whether that detail influenced the subject selection here is unknown, but it is not an arbitrary tourist pick.
